Book excerpt: Orlando Innamorato of Matteo Maria Boiardo Matteo Maria Boiardo Matteo Maria, 1440 - 19/20 December 1494, was an Italian Renaissance poet. Boiardo was born in 1440, [1] at or near, Scandiano (today's province of Reggio Emilia); the son of Giovanni di Feltrino and Lucia Strozzi, he was of noble lineage, ranking as Count of Scandiano, with seignorial power over Arceto, Casalgrande, Gesso, and Torricella. Boiardo was an ideal example of a gifted and accomplished courtier, possessing at the same time a manly heart and deep humanistic learning.At an early age he entered the University of Ferrara, where he acquired a good knowledge of Greek and Latin, and even of the Oriental languages.
